Original Description
Konstantin Korovin’s Les Boulevards La Nuit A Paris (1900s) is a luminous ode to Parisian nightlife, pulsating with the rhythmic energy of the Belle Époque. The painting immerses viewers in the glow of gaslit boulevards, where blurred carriages and strolling figures dissolve into swirls of warm yellows, cool blues, and hazy violets—a testament to Korovin’s mastery of Impressionism and his Russian interpretation of French plein air traditions. As a leading figure of the Mir iskusstva (World of Art) movement, Korovin bridged Russian realism with Western European modernism, and this work exemplifies his bold, expressive brushwork and chromatic intensity. Historically, it reflects the cultural exchange between Russia and France, while standing as a rare nocturnal counterpart to daytime Impressionist cityscapes. The painting’s atmospheric ambiguity, oscillating between realism and abstraction, secures its significance in early 20th-century avant-garde.
